A novel multilayered flower-like structure of BiOBr was fabricated by mild and facile polyvinylpyrrolidone (PVP) K30-assisted hydrothermal method using stable, less toxic inorganic salts Bi(NO3)3•5H2O and NaBr as the starting materials. Such three-dimensional (3D) BiOBr assemblies were constructed layer-by-layer from a large number of two-dimensional (2D) nanoplates. Rhodamine B (RhB) photocatalytic degradation experiments showed that the BiOBr flowers exhibited higher visible-light photocatalytic activity than that of irregular BiOBr nanoplates. Therefore, the resulting flower-like BiOBr are very promising photocatalysts for the treatment of organic pollutants
